Work at SourceForge, help us to make it a better place! We have an immediate need for a Support Technician in our San Francisco or Denver office.

Close

sbcl Log


Commit Date  
[8464b7] (sbcl_0_9_9) by William Harold Newman William Harold Newman

0.9.9:
release, tagged as sbcl_0_9_9

2006-01-26 19:29:11 Tree
[e76b59] by Juho Snellman Juho Snellman

0.9.8.48:
Disable fast_bzero_sse for FreeBSD systems with kernels that
don't have SSE support. Patch by NIIMI Satoshi on sbcl-devel,
"Re: upcoming sbcl-0.9.9 release".

2006-01-22 18:55:05 Tree
[ee41b1] by Juho Snellman Juho Snellman

0.9.8.47:
Clear the direction flag on Lisp -> C transitions, as
required by the x86-64 ABI. Fixes mysterious GC crashes on
SuSE. (reported by Andrej Grozin and Hendrik Maryns)

2006-01-20 08:34:56 Tree
[3dfa1b] by Rudi Schlatte Rudi Schlatte

0.9.8.46
Merge patch "Charsets: latin-N, N=2,...,8" from Ivan Boldyrev,
sbcl-devel 2006-01-17

2006-01-19 17:02:33 Tree
[87943e] by Rudi Schlatte Rudi Schlatte

0.9.8.45
Briefly document bivalent streams.

2006-01-19 15:15:07 Tree
[148ae8] by Christophe Rhodes Christophe Rhodes

0.9.8.44:
Fix for (truename #p"/") (reported by tomppa on #lisp)

2006-01-18 12:57:46 Tree
[9015ef] by Christophe Rhodes Christophe Rhodes

0.9.8.43:
Commit patch from Luis Oliveira for alignment on #!+win32

2006-01-18 11:28:28 Tree
[0d48b1] by Christophe Rhodes Christophe Rhodes

0.9.8.42:
Merge "first round of i/o fixes" (sbcl-devel 2006-01-13
from James Bielman)
... some extended horribleness, mostly isolated horribleness.

2006-01-16 15:39:57 Tree
[ed3295] by Christophe Rhodes Christophe Rhodes

0.9.8.41:
Fix the mop/sb-posix/interface.pure.lisp/PCL metacircularity
problem.
... treat GF-DFUN-STATE and (SETF GF-DFUN-STATE) specially.
... thanks to everyone who thought very hard about it!
... also make interface.pure.lisp actually pure.

2006-01-16 15:10:24 Tree
[471a5d] by Christophe Rhodes Christophe Rhodes

0.9.8.40:
Merge patch from Luis Oliveira "stdcall support for alien-funcall"
sbcl-devel 2006-01-12
... factor set-fpu-word-for-{c,lisp} out from number-stack-space
manipulating vops.
... magic to adjust for calling convention.

2006-01-16 14:45:46 Tree
[a87a86] by Andreas Fuchs Andreas Fuchs

0.9.8.39:
make sb-posix's asd file load sb-grovel with asdf

This change should make it possible to run tests even
if sb-grovel is not in $SBCL_HOME.

2006-01-14 20:01:07 Tree
[944ada] by Juho Snellman Juho Snellman

0.9.8.38:
Log a BUG.

2006-01-13 11:32:46 Tree
[d8ff33] by Andreas Fuchs Andreas Fuchs

0.9.7.37:
Make asdf-install use bivalent streams

* Fix warnings and style-warnings when compiling a-i/installer.lisp:
remove undefined variables / exported symbols *verify-gpg-signatures*
and *safe-url-prefixes*, add a few ignored declarations.
* Add :element-type :default to stream opening forms that need it
* Allow sb-executable's copy-stream to deal with bivalent streams:
Add an element-type &key argument that should be passed when copying
bivalent streams

2006-01-12 13:26:41 Tree
[bd5dfa] by Christophe Rhodes Christophe Rhodes

0.9.8.36:
->pure, not ->slots[15] in purify
... independent of whether 7 clos-hash slots get deleted, this
might prevent future maintainers making the same kind of
fool of themselves as I did with my "inconsequential
modifications" error...

2006-01-12 09:31:21 Tree
[607f3e] by Nathan Froyd Nathan Froyd

0.9.8.35:
Add getpwnam and getpwuid to SB-POSIX...
* ...in a fit of frustration ("why does this work in sb-bsd-sockets
and the exact same thing not work here?"), remove the
SB-POSIX-INTERNAL package and throw everything into SB-POSIX.
No more lurking issues with packages.

2006-01-11 21:32:19 Tree
[48ec28] by Christophe Rhodes Christophe Rhodes

0.9.8.34:
Merge patch from nyef for load-shared-object on win32.
... there's a scary amount of duplication between
win32-foreign-load and foreign-load; hope some
gardening takes place at some point.
... attempt to make make-config.sh put the relevant target
features in place.

2006-01-11 14:28:35 Tree
[2e86a7] by Christophe Rhodes Christophe Rhodes

0.9.8.33:
From James Bielman: dirname() for win32.

2006-01-11 13:33:20 Tree
[ddea55] by Christophe Rhodes Christophe Rhodes

0.9.8.32:
Sucks to be me.
... insert missing semicolon in win32-os.c. Why? Why why why?

2006-01-11 11:58:59 Tree
[6c786e] by Christophe Rhodes Christophe Rhodes

0.9.8.31:
Implement (following James Bielman) unix-access for windows.
... use access() not _access(); no, I have no idea why this
makes sense (in either direction).

2006-01-10 17:39:28 Tree
[c07dbf] by Christophe Rhodes Christophe Rhodes

0.9.8.30:
Fix for --load on Win32 (patch from James Bielman)

2006-01-10 16:17:04 Tree
[842dd5] by Juho Snellman Juho Snellman

0.9.8.29:
Kill a couple of obsolete x86 instructions (illegal in 64-bit
mode). Patch from sbcl-devel "Tidying up
src/compiler/x86-64/insts.lisp" by Lutz Euler on 2006-01-08.

2006-01-09 23:13:19 Tree
[a4cffc] by Juho Snellman Juho Snellman

0.9.8.28:
Oh, the embarrassment. x86-64 was using full calls to GENERIC-< and
GENERIC-> for (UN)SIGNED-BYTE-64-P and CHECK-(UN)SIGNED-BYTE-64.
Fix it.

* Conditionalize type predicate, type predicate wrapper and
typecheckfun creation on N-WORD-BITS. Add missing 64-bit
cases.
* Add missing SIGNED-BYTE-64 VOPs.
* Nuke the now-unused 32-bit VOPs.

2006-01-09 22:46:14 Tree
[04d819] by Christophe Rhodes Christophe Rhodes

0.9.8.27:
Merge patch from James Bielman fixing self-build under Win32.
... a little bit of an accident ensued; I ran
canonicalize-whitespace on .sh files, which seemed to
work (except on wc.sh) until it scribbled all over
make.sh, confusing the shell interpreter utterly.
... the resulting files have built the system, nevertheless.

2006-01-09 13:00:17 Tree
[732ad8] by Christophe Rhodes Christophe Rhodes

0.9.8.26:
Merge patch from James Bielman fixing use of GNAME on
fast_bzero* assembly functions.

2006-01-09 12:45:47 Tree
[bb8a05] by Christophe Rhodes Christophe Rhodes

0.9.8.25:
Merge patch from Luis Oliviera (sbcl-devel 2006-01-08) fixing
probe-file on Win32.

2006-01-08 22:39:03 Tree
Older >